Warning Signs You Need Commercial Water Damage Restoration

Catching water damage early can save you time, money, and stress. Look out for these warning signs: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Don’t ignore musty odors that linger long after a cleaning or repair. This could be a sign of hidden water damage or mold growth.

Water Stains on Walls or Ceilings

Water stains on walls or ceilings can be a sign of water damage or leaks. Don’t dismiss these stains as minor; they could be indicative of a larger problem.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of water damage or poor drainage. Don’t walk on these areas, as they can collapse or become unstable.

Visible Signs of Mold Growth

Don’t ignore visible signs of mold growth, including black spots or slimy patches. This can be a sign of water damage or poor ventilation.

Sewage Backup or Overflow

Don’t wait if you experience a sewage backup or overflow. This can be a sign of a larger problem with your plumbing or septic system.

Unclean or Unusual Smells

Don’t ignore unclean or unusual smells in your property. This could be a sign of hidden water damage or mold growth.

Commercial Water Damage Restoration v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small water spill in a residential area Yes No You can likely clean and dry the area yourself.
Large water damage incident in a commercial area No Yes You’ll need specialized equipment and expertise to restore the property.
Hidden water damage in walls or ceilings No Yes Hidden water damage needs specialized equipment to detect and extract.
Sewage backup or overflow No Yes These incidents need specialized equipment and expertise to clean and disinfect.
Property with significant structural damage No Yes Structural damage needs a professional assessment and restoration plan.
Property with high-value assets or historical significance No Yes Professional restoration is necessary to preserve the asset’s value or historical integrity.

Commercial Water Damage Restoration Cost In Canton, MI

The cost of commercial water damage restoration in Canton, MI, varies depending on the severity and size of the affected area. Our team will provide a detailed estimate after inspecting your property. Keep in mind that prices may range from $500 to $2,500 or more, depending on the extent of the damage and the necessary repairs.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ction and Removal $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area and type of water damage
Drying and Dehumidification $1,000 – $3,000 Size of affected area and type of equipment needed
Cleaning and Disinfection $500 – $1,500 Size of affected area and type of cleaning products needed
Restoration and Reconstruction $2,000 – $5,000 or more Size and complexity of repairs, type of materials needed
Professional Inspection and Assessment $200 – $500 Size of property and type of inspection needed
Insurance Claims Help $0 – $500 Size of property and complexity of claims process
